Output 8c122c99332280659f24bbb2f6ada6b89fdd8e8a393090931e36a4e40bdc4f29:0

value
133111
script pubkey
OP_0 OP_PUSHBYTES_20 d41e9e02e779b2a50bfc0202e69d594333296a56
address
bc1q6s0fuqh80xe22zluqgpwd82egvejj6jk4ktqkw
transaction
8c122c99332280659f24bbb2f6ada6b89fdd8e8a393090931e36a4e40bdc4f29
confirmations
46858
spent
true